Engage by Design Content Series: STEMulating Design Challenges in Science, Grades 6-8 - 27461
Explore ways to implement TEKS-aligned design challenges in your science classroom. Experience using the engineering design process to address design challenges in order to support student growth and success in your classroom and beyond. Participants will receive a printed copy of "STEMulating Desing Challenges in Science, Grades 6-8," and digital access as well as a license for digital access.
